Hello all.

I'm a City fan from birth. I live in Kettering.

I watched every game between 1986 and 1990 before I played serious Saturday football and got a family.

I watch roughly 6 games a year now but always follow and looks for results wherever I am in the world.

My favorite memory is Mark Venus scoring against Swindon Town on 7th Nov 87. Mark was often a scape goat for our poor results at the time but he had the last laugh in this game with the winning goal deep into injury time. 2-0 down with 15 mins left and the game looked lost before Paul Ramsey came on. He scored soon after and Steve Walsh followed up in the last minute to make the draw iminent. With time ticking and the whistle nearly on the ref's whistle, Venus unleashed from 22yards. Imagine the joy seeing it buried in the top corner.

Many, many more memories but somehow this one always sticks with me.
